CBSE OSM Issues: Class 12 students have raised alarms after discovering multiple inconsistencies in the Central Board of Secondary Education's (CBSE) On-Screen Marking (OSM) evaluation system, including full answers recorded as blank pages, correct one‑mark MCQs receiving only 0.5 marks, and other apparent marking anomalies. Complaints surfaced on social media following the release of scanned evaluated answer sheets and marks.
A user shared images of CBSE 12th evaluated answer book pages with student answers displayed as "blank" in the evaluated scan.
Another student shared the instance of one‑mark objective questions (MCQs) being awarded 0.5 marks despite the response matching the official answer key.
However, users have pointed out that it could be due to spelling errors from the student side.
With students waiting for their scanned copy of answer sheets, parents have expressed that their children received less than what they expected.
The CBSE re-evaluation process has also come under criticism as several students and parents report unusual payment glitches on the official portal. Several screenshots circulating online showed abnormal fee amounts appearing on the CBSE portal.
